Organic chemistry is a branch of chemistry that focuses on the study of carbon-based compounds, particularly those found in living organisms. It is a vast and diverse field that encompasses the study of the structure, properties, composition, and reactions of organic compounds.

Uses of metals?

Metals find numerous applications across various industries and everyday life due to their unique properties. Some common uses of metals include:

1. Construction: Metals like steel, aluminum, and titanium are widely used in construction for building structures, bridges, and infrastructure due to their strength, durability, and ability to withstand heavy loads.

2. Transportation: Metals are essential in transportation industries for making vehicles, aircraft, ships, and train tracks. Steel, aluminum, and copper are commonly used in manufacturing automotive parts, aircraft frames, ship hulls, and electrical wiring.

3. Electronics: Metals such as copper, silver, and gold are crucial components in electronic devices and circuitry due to their excellent electrical conductivity. They are used in wiring, connectors, integrated circuits, and printed circuit boards.

4. Packaging: Metals like aluminum and steel are extensively used in packaging materials for food, beverages, and pharmaceuticals due to their strength, barrier properties, and recyclability.

5. Energy: Metals play vital roles in energy production and storage. For example, copper is used in electrical wiring and motors, while metals like lithium and cobalt are essential components in batteries for electric vehicles and renewable energy storage systems.

6. Medicine: Metals are used in medical devices, implants, and equipment due to their biocompatibility and durability. Titanium, stainless steel, and cobalt-chromium alloys are commonly used in orthopedic implants and surgical instruments.

7. Tools and Machinery: Metals are fundamental in manufacturing tools, machinery, and equipment for various industries. High-strength steel, iron, and aluminum alloys are used in manufacturing cutting tools, gears, engines, and industrial machinery.

8. Jewelry: Precious metals like gold, silver, and platinum are valued for their beauty and rarity, making them popular choices for jewelry and decorative items.

9. Defense and Aerospace: Metals are critical in defense and aerospace applications for manufacturing weapons, armor, aircraft, and spacecraft components. Aluminum, titanium, and high-strength steel alloys are commonly used in these industries.

10. Art and Sculpture: Metals are widely used in artistic and sculptural creations due to their malleability, durability, and aesthetic appeal. Artists utilize metals like bronze, brass, and stainless steel to create sculptures, monuments, and architectural elements.

These are just a few examples of the diverse and essential uses of metals across various sectors of society.
